Wendy Jensen (born 22 January 1964 in Auckland, New Zealand) is a lawn bowls competitor for New Zealand.[1]

Jensen won a bronze medal at the 2004 World Outdoor Bowls Championship in Leamington Spa.[2]
Jensen won a bronze medal in the women's fours at the 2002 Commonwealth Games.[3]
Jensen has won two gold medals at the Asia Pacific Bowls Championships, the latest at the 2019 Asia Pacific Bowls Championships in the Gold Coast, Queensland.[4][5]
